Gross Weight (MTOW) | 1430 lbs. |
VNE - Never Exceed Speed | 120 MPH |
VH Max. Cruise Speed at 5500 RPM at Sea Level | 105 MPH |
Full Fuel Range with 30 minute Day VFR reserves (as required by FAA) | 75% Power at 5000 RPM burns 5.3 Gal/hr at 98 MPH with 30 minute reserve yields 430 miles at Sea Level 55% Power at 4500 RPM burns 3.0 Gal/hr at 81 MPH with 30 minute reserve yields 554 miles at Sea Level |
Engine Power Output (Rotax 914 UL) | Max Power: 115 HP (84.5 KW) at 5800 RPM, max 5 minutes Max Continuous Power: 99.9 HP (73.5 KW) at 5500 RPM |
Vy – Best Rate of Climb Speed | 63 MPH IAS with 10 degrees of flaps |
Vx – Best Angle of Climb Speed | 58 MPH IAS with 20 degrees of flaps |
Vs - Stall Speed with Flaps not Extended | 47 MPH IAS |
Vso – Stall Speed with Flaps Extended | 40 MPH IAS with Flaps 30° |
Va – Maneuvering Speed at gross weight | 92 MPH KCAS 94 MPH IAS |
Va (min) – Maneuvering Speed at minimum weight | 79 MPH KCAS 82 MPH IAS |
Total Fuel Capacity | 23 Gallons |
Total Usable Fuel | 22 Gallons |
Service Ceiling | 17.000 ft |
COLOR | IAS | DESCRIPTION |
White Arc | 40 – 80 MPH | Full Flap Operating Range Lower limit is at Gross Weight. VSO in landing configuration. Upper limit is maximum speed permissible with flaps extended. Vfe |
Green Arc | 47 – 94 MPH | Normal Operating Range Lower limit is at Gross Weight. VS with flaps retracted. Upper limit is maximum structural cruising speed (Vno) |
Yellow Arc | 94 – 120 MPH | Caution Range Operations must be conducted with caution and only in smooth air. |
Red Line | 120 MPH | Never Exceed Speed - Vne |
This aircraft is intended for non-aerobatic flight and the following maneuvers are approved:
- 1.Any maneuvers incidental to normal flying
- 2.Stalls (except whip stalls)
- 3.Lazy eights, chandelles and steep turns in which angle of bank does not exceed 40 degrees
General limitations for maneuvering in this aircraft are:
30 degrees pitch, 40 degrees angle of bank
WARNING
Aerobatic maneuvers, including spins, are not permitted.
